a 30-n net force on a skater produces an acceleration of 0.6 m/s2. what is the mass of the skater

Answer:

The answer is 50 kg

Explanation:

The mass of the skater can be found by using the formula

[tex]m = \frac{f}{a} \\ [/tex]

f is the force

a is the acceleration

From the question we have

[tex]m = \frac{30}{0.6} \\ [/tex]

We have the final answer as

50 kg
